Step-by-Step Guide to Obtain Your Passport
Now, let's dive into the nitty-gritty of obtaining your passport in Grove City. Follow these steps for a smooth application process:
- Gather Required Documents: You’ll need proof of U.S. citizenship (like a birth certificate) and a valid photo ID (like a driver’s license).
- Complete the Application Form: Fill out Form DS-11 if you are applying for your first passport. You can complete it online or print it out.
- Passport Photos: You need two recent passport-sized photos. Many local pharmacies or photo shops can help with this.
- Payment: Be prepared to pay the application fee. Check the current fees on the U.S. State Department website.
- Submit Your Application: Bring all your documents, photos, and payment to the Grove City Post Office. You’ll submit your application in person.
- Track Your Application: After a few weeks, you can track your application status online.

What About Expedited Service?
Need your passport in a hurry? Sometimes life throws curveballs, and you might need to travel sooner than expected. Don’t fret! You can request expedited service for an additional fee. It typically reduces the processing time to about 5-7 business days. Just remember, this option might not always be available, so check ahead of time!
Things to Keep in Mind
Here are a few tips to keep in mind when applying for your passport:
- Check your documents for accuracy before submitting. Missing or incorrect information can delay your application.
- It's best to apply during off-peak hours to avoid long lines.
- Keep a copy of your application and all submitted documents for your records.
And hey, here's a thought: Have you considered a passport card? It’s a wallet-sized card that’s acceptable for land and sea travel between the U.S., Canada, Mexico, and some Caribbean countries. It’s handy if you’re planning a road trip!
